☐ **Key ceremony step 6 — Hermetic build cutover (Project Bindle).** Support folks, this one's on you to witness: when we flip Bindle's pipeline to the new hermetic build system, the old signing keys get retired and fresh ones are minted inside the sealed builder. Two witnesses confirm the fingerprint on screen, then the ceremony lead unseals the escrow drawer. To unlock the escrow tool, enter the recovery passphrase, which is:

unlock words, kajef-kadug: sorys-pelax-lamael-tamvan-briiel-novdor-fenwyn-tamdor-oliion-keleth-julok-belion-ralok

## Local Setup — Fonts

The Quillmark app vendors all third-party fonts under `assets/fonts/` so builds never hit external CDNs. Run `make fonts` after cloning to verify checksums; the build fails loudly if a face is missing or altered. Font metadata (license, version, checksum) lives in the catalog database, not in the repo. If you're on call and the checksum job is red, inspect the catalog directly using the connection string below.

warehouse DSN: mssql://rusdor_svc:0FSWCn9@db-951a.paliqforge.local:5432/ulawyn

Quick heads-up from the Ops crew at Bramleigh & Voss: the mail room has moved! It's no longer by reception — it's now on the lower ground floor, next to the print hub in Westerly Wing. Post runs still happen at 10:00 and 15:00. Couriers buzz through as before, but you'll collect parcels yourself now. The new mail room door needs the code below.

staff pass of kawip-hawef = bdg-QLP-2

Handover Note — to the incoming Director of Operations, Quillbar Logistics. The hiring freeze in the Westhollow distribution division remains in effect through year-end. Two approved exceptions (safety roles) are documented in the staffing file. Morale is fragile; I recommend a town hall within your first month. Backfill requests should be deferred, not denied outright. The confidential rationale appears below:

internal memo for faweg-tafog: Only 7 of the 100 pilot accounts renewed Quenael, so a churn review is set for April 15.